The place of La Muralla is inside the municipality of Putla Villa de Guerrero (in the State of Oaxaca). There are 346 inhabitants. Of all the towns in the municipality, it occupies the number #31 in terms of number of inhabitants. La Muralla is at 821 meters of altitude.

#2 The population of La Muralla (Oaxaca) is 346 inhabitants
Year | Female Inhabitants | Male inhabitants | Total population |
---|---|---|---|
2020 | 183 | 163 | 346 |
2010 | 146 | 126 | 272 |
2005 | 167 | 142 | 309 |
